Players run a single command, the bot spins up a private voice room, fills it with the squad, and tears it down when the lobby empties. No more hunting through channels, no more half-full lobbies — just clean, fast matchmaking.

When a player queues, the bot creates a fresh voice channel, names it
🎮 {game} | {owner}, sets the user limit, and assigns the squad.
When everyone leaves, the room disappears automatically.

Players pick the platform when they queue, so squads form around the same ecosystem. Admins can disable platforms per server to match your community.

A control panel lives inside Discord — staff can force-close rooms, change limits, blacklist abusive players, and override the queue without leaving the server.
Two ways to find teammates — post an open LFG for the community, or jump straight into a private room.
Run /lfg create or tap 🟢 Find Teammates on the panel. Pick your game, platform, and mode — takes about 10 seconds.
Your post goes live in the game thread. A notify role ping goes out so the right players see it instantly.
When someone's ready to play, hit 🎮 Create Game Room on the LFG post. A private voice channel spawns immediately.
Members join with one click. Lock the room, adjust the limit, kick if needed — you're in control.
Room empties or owner leaves? Bot deletes the channel and updates the LFG post. Zero clutter.
